- Define Your Needs and Budget
Start by assessing your needs and setting a realistic budget. Consider factors such as the number of passengers you need to accommodate, the typical driving conditions, and the features you desire. Defining a budget will help you narrow down your choices and avoid falling in love with a car that stretches your finances beyond comfort.
- Research Vehicle Options
With your needs and budget in mind, begin researching the available vehicle options. Check consumer reviews, expert ratings, and safety reports to get a better understanding of each car’s performance and reliability. Focus on vehicles that align with your requirements and have a track record of satisfying owners.
- Consider Fuel Efficiency and Environmental Impact
Ontario has a diverse landscape, so it’s crucial to consider fuel efficiency, especially if you plan on traveling long distances. Additionally, eco-conscious buyers may want to explore hybrid or electric vehicle options to minimize their environmental impact and take advantage of various incentives available in the province.
- Check Insurance Costs
Before finalizing your decision, obtain insurance quotes for the vehicles you are considering. Insurance costs can vary significantly based on factors such as the car’s make and model, safety features, and your driving history. Make sure the insurance premiums fit your budget and don’t come as a surprise after purchase.
- Investigate Vehicle History Reports
When buying a pre-owned car, request a comprehensive vehicle history report. This report provides valuable information about the car’s past, including accidents, maintenance records, and ownership history. A clean vehicle history report increases your confidence in the car’s condition and reliability.
- Take a Test Drive
Never skip the test drive! It’s the best way to evaluate how a vehicle handles, how comfortable it is, and whether it suits your driving preferences. Test the car on different road types to get a comprehensive feel for its performance.
- Consult a Trusted Mechanic
Before sealing the deal, have the car inspected by a trusted mechanic. A professional inspection can uncover hidden issues and help you negotiate a fair price or avoid a potentially problematic purchase altogether.
- Review Ontario’s Buying and Registration Process
Familiarize yourself with Ontario’s buying and registration process, including the necessary paperwork and fees. Ensure you have all the required documents, such as a Safety Standards Certificate and the Used Vehicle Information Package.
